Born in Natick, MA, Nancy graduated from Medfield, MA, high school and Colby College with a degree in Psychology. Upon graduation she was hired as an Air Hostess, today known as flight attendant, with Capitol Airlines during the early days of commercial aviation and left service when she married her late husband, Ralph E. “Zeke” Darby. They shared a love of golf and travel and spent many winters in Sydney, Australia after Zeke retired in 1985.
Nancy is survived by her children Dana and his wife Lisa Darby, and Douglas. Also surviving are her three grandchildren Zachary, Sydney, and Samantha, and her sister Barbara.
